Spruce Hill Veterinary Clinic (SHVC) is a 4-doctor small animal hospital located at the corner of Plumtree and Allen Streets in Springfield, MA. We treat dogs, cats, birds, rabbits and rodents, and offer a full range of medical and surgical services. The veterinarians and staff members are dedicated to providing the very best care to our wonderful patients and their caring owners. We feel fortunate to have a profession that allows us to work with animals, and be able to help them when help is needed. We are also licensed as wildlife rehabilitators, and volunteer our services to treat injured birds, rabbits and rodents.

Why Spruce Hill Veterinary Clinic Established, reputable hospital with a loyal and respectful client base Supportive, experienced medical team that values collaboration Strong technician utilization and trust in technician skills Emphasis on quality medicine Our Hospital and Medicine Full-service small animal hospital for cats and dogs and support wildlife rehabilitators in the area Routine soft tissue surgery Dentistry with digital dental radiography In-house Idexx lab equipment and digital radiography IV catheter placement, IV fluids, and full monitoring for all anesthetic patients Butterfly ultrasound machine Experienced support staff who play a critical role in patient and client care  You can learn more about our amazing practice at https://sprucehillveterinaryclinic.com/ What You Will Do This role is hands-on and patient-focused. You will be deeply involved in both medical care and client communication. Responsibilities include: Assisting doctors with exams, procedures, and surgeries • Confident blood draws on both dogs and cats • Administering medications and vaccinations • Understanding and following vaccine protocols • Strong foundational knowledge of pharmacology • Compassionate and effective restraint and low-stress handling techniques • Involvement in patient diagnostics including lab work and imaging • Delivering exceptional customer service through client education Client education is a major part of this role. We are looking for someone who is comfortable explaining treatment plans, vaccine protocols, preventive care, and post-operative instructions clearly and confidently. Our technicians help build trust with our clients. They are educators and advocates for their patients.
